EC24C64TN is a 64\/32-Kbit I2C-compatible Serial EEPROM (Electrically Erasable Programmable Memory) device. The device is designed to operate in a supply voltage range of 1.7V to 5.5V, with a maximum of 1MHz transfer rate. The operating temperature range is from -40\u00b0C to +105\u00b0C. The device incorporates a Write Protection pin used for hardware Write Protection on the whole memory array. The Serial EEPROM memory is organized as 256\/128 pages of 32 bytes each, totaling 8192\/4096*8 bits. The EC24C64TN offers an additional 32-byte Identification Page for users to store sensitive application parameters. This page can be permanently locked in Read-only mode after the application data is written into the Identification Page. The EC24C64TN also offers a separate memory block containing a factory programmed 128-bit Unique ID. This block is in Read-only mode and can be accessed to by sending a specific Read command.
